People of America, on behalf of your fellow countrymen allow me to enter this plea to you: Stop getting tattoos celebrating championships that don’t exist yet. It is almost always going to end very badly for you.

Take Mike, for instance. Mike is a St. Louis Blues fan, who won a contest from “The Rizzuto Show” on 105.7 FM the Point in St. Louis. The show asked fans what they would do to win a free St. Louis tattoo. The best answer won.

Mike’s winning answer was a little bit on the crass side (or a lot), but that was nothing compared to what he decided to get for his free tattoo. If it's free, ya gotta go big, right?

So Mike went all in on this being the year that the Stanley Cup was finally going to come to St. Louis. In a gigantic tattoo on his leg, Mike had the good folks over at Big Dave’s The Ink Spot in Troy, Missouri, put a giant Blues “2015 Stanley Cup Champions” logo on his leg in full color.

The St. Louis Blues did not win the Stanley Cup in 2015, in case you haven’t been following along this year. No one has yet. But the Blues most definitely won’t as they were eliminated by the Minnesota Wild in six games... in the first round.

At least Mike didn't have to pay for this.
